| Property | Value | Source |
|---|---|---|
| Molecular Mass | 149.15 g/mol | CAS Common Chemistry |
| 149.149 g/mol | RDKit | |
| Density | 1.16 g/cm³ | CAS Common Chemistry |
| 1.1552 g/cm3 @ 32.5 °C | CAS Common Chemistry | |
| Canonical SMILES | O=N(=O)C=1C=CC=C(C=C)C1 | CAS Common Chemistry |
| InChI | InChI=1S/C8H7NO2/c1-2-7-4-3-5-8(6-7)9(10)11/h2-6H,1H2 | CAS Common Chemistry |
| InChI Key | InChIKey=SYZVQXIUVGKCBJ-UHFFFAOYSA-N | CAS Common Chemistry |
| Melting Point | -10 °C | CAS Common Chemistry |
| Name | 3-Nitrostyrene | CAS Common Chemistry |
| Heavy Atom Count | 11 | RDKit |
| Hydrogen Bond Acceptors | 2 | RDKit |
| Hydrogen Bond Donors | 0 | RDKit |
| Rotatable Bonds | 2 | RDKit |
| Aromatic Ring Count | 1 | RDKit |
| Topological Polar Surface Area | 43.14 Ų | RDKit |
| LogP | 2.2378 | RDKit |
| Molar Refractivity | 43.18740000000002 cm³/mol | RDKit |
| Ring Count | 1 | RDKit |
| Formal Charge | 0 | RDKit |
| Fraction Csp3 | 0.0 | RDKit |
| Exact Mass | 149.047678464 g/mol | RDKit |
| Boiling Point | 96-100 °C @ 3 Torr | CAS Common Chemistry |
